Synonyms of cutting off

Noun


1. abscission, cutting off, removal, remotion

usage: the act of cutting something off

2. cut, cutting, cutting off, shortening

usage: the act of shortening something by chopping off the ends; "the barber gave him a good cut"

Verb


1. interrupt, disrupt, break up, cut off, break, break off, discontinue, stop

usage: make a break in; "We interrupt the program for the following messages"

2. cut, cut off, interrupt, disrupt, break up, cut off

usage: cease, stop; "cut the noise"; "We had to cut short the conversation"

3. cut off, chop off, lop off, detach, come off, come away

usage: remove by or as if by cutting; "cut off the ear"; "lop off the dead branch"

4. cut off, cut out, intercept, stop

usage: cut off and stop; "The bicyclist was cut out by the van"

5. chip, knap, cut off, break off, cut

usage: break a small piece off from; "chip the glass"; "chip a tooth"

6. amputate, cut off, remove, take, take away, withdraw

usage: remove surgically; "amputate limbs"
